Let’s talk about the “Great Tomato Incident” from last spring. Think of a white sectional, some spaghetti sauce, and a toddler. A lot of people would cry. Instead of rubbing, you should dab. That sofa got a new life thanks to cold water and a vinegar rinse produced at home. What did you find out? Don’t panic; it will just make things worse.

Then there was the retriever who had just come out of the water and ran right to the couch. The smell of wet fur and water persisted in the air for days. Baking soda saved the day in this scenario. Sprinkle, wait, and then clean up. Open the windows. Do it again if you need to. What did you learn? Sometimes, your nose can tell you more than a pretty label can.

Who could forget the “surprise” paint splash that occured when a craft project went awry on a rainy day? Quickly scrape it off, then dab it with warm, soapy water. Don’t use hot water unless you want to get paint on your furnishings. It turns out that waiting gets the paint out, but scraping just pushes the color deeper.

It can be tougher to get rid of old stains than it is to solve a cryptic crossword. For weeks, one house in the vicinity had to deal with a red wine spill before seeking for aid. It’s a painful lesson: the longer a stain sits, the harder it is to get rid of. You need a specialist to aid with some problems.
